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
71184 1577599 48236164
24952 92371 77669
24952 92371 77669
0049146 104525 10668 57880
All about undefined
Interested in learning more?
24952 92371 77669
0049146 104525 10668 57880
See more
372591 95582017901
85 3518968335 54
See more
56774238 127735265 33458718
6974698 2681700465 58566642
See more